Kira is a Russian form of Kyra, which is a feminine form of Kyros, the Greek form of the Persian name Kurush. Kurush may mean 'far sighted' or may be related to the Persian word 'khur' - 'sun'. The name is sometimes associated with Greek 'kyrios' 'lord'. This was the name of several kings of Persia , including Cyrus the Great, who conquered Babylon . He is famous in the Bible for freeing the captive Jews and allowing them to return to Israel .
